About this application

DOS Browser is a specialized application created for Linux environments that serves as a browser featuring built-in acceleration for vintage DOS and Windows 9x games. The software integrates compatibility layers and optimization routines directly into the browsing interface, allowing users to run older software titles with reduced configuration overhead. It handles the execution environment for legacy titles while providing a centralized menu system for organization and navigation.

The application focuses on streamlining the process of launching and playing historical computer games on modern Linux distributions. By incorporating hardware acceleration techniques compatible with older instruction sets, it attempts to maintain expected performance levels for titles originally written for MS-DOS and early Windows iterations. Users interact with a dedicated file structure and interface tailored specifically to managing historical software archives.
